主要的 Vulvovaginal 黑色素瘤:一个十五年的多学科团队经验

概括
性阴道黑色素瘤是一种罕见的癌症,经常呈现变化. 这项研究审查了15个案例,发现广泛的局部切除是最常见的,并突出数字摄影用于早期检测和监测.
科学领域:
- 妇科瘤学 妇科瘤学
- 皮肤病学 皮肤病学
- 黑色素瘤研究 黑色素瘤研究
背景情况:
- 性阴道黑色素瘤是一种不常见的妇科恶性瘤.
- 它与预后不佳和各种临床表现有关.
- 早期检测和有效的治疗策略仍然是关键的挑战.
研究的目的:
- 审查 vulvovaginal 黑色素瘤的临床表现,治疗和结果.
- 评估序列数码摄影在治疗这种罕见癌症中的实用性.
- 确定影响患者结果的因素.
主要方法:
- 对被诊断患有 vulvovaginal 黑色素瘤的患者进行了 15 年的回顾性图表审查.
- 对治疗方式的分析,重点是手术干预,如广泛局部切除.
- 实施和评估串行数字摄影用于监视和教育.
主要成果:
- 在这15年的时间里,发现了15例阴部黑色素瘤.
- 广泛的局部切除是采用的主要治疗方式.
- 序列数码摄影对于监测疾病进展和复发是有益的.
结论:
- Vulvovaginal 黑色素瘤需要多学科的方法,因为它的稀有性和不良的预后.
- 宽局部切除术是经常使用的手术治疗方法.
- 序列数码摄影可以通过改进检测和监测来加强 vulvovaginal 黑色素瘤的管理.

Skin Cancer
5.7K
Skin cancer is a type of cancer that occurs when there is an abnormal growth of skin cells, usually triggered by damage to the DNA within the skin cells. It is primarily caused by exposure to ultraviolet (UV) radiation from the sun or artificial sources like tanning beds. Skin cancer is the most common type of cancer worldwide, and its incidence continues to rise.
